Rawayana's Latin Grammy Surprise: Caribbean Roots Shine

Beto Montenegro reflected on Rawayana's arduous yet beautiful artistic journey, emphasizing a process built on gradual steps and resilience rather than speed. He noted that the band's evolution has been remarkably transparent, with their public presence online showcasing every mistake and success to a growing fanbase.

This openness has fostered a sense of solidity, as all stages of their development are visible. Montenegro highlighted the consistent use of Caribbean slang and cultural nuances from the outset, which has now become a recognizable element of their sound. This authentic foundation played a significant role in their trajectory.

The band experienced profound surprise when one of their songs, which they felt possessed a special quality, garnered a Latin Grammy nomination. Montenegro acknowledged that this recognition was unexpected, processing the joyous astonishment that accompanied this significant career milestone.
